Dining Guide for Club Med Guilin

Four restaurants and three bars. The Atelier is the main international buffet for all three meals. The Lotus (adults 12+, HOMA building) is à la carte Chinese and Western, reservation required for dinner. The Rooftop Restaurant does Mongolian BBQ and Hot Pot with 360° mountain views, reservation required. The Noodle Bar runs Guilin regional noodles throughout the day without reservation.

The Lotus

Included

Chinese specialties, Western

Adults-only (12+) specialty restaurant in the HOMA building. À la carte set dinner menu blending traditional Chinese with Western influences. Traditional lazy Susan table tops and garden seating. Reservation required for dinner — reserve at check-in on arrival day. Also serves late lunch. Smart casual dress.

The Rooftop Restaurant

Included

Mongolian BBQ, Chinese Hot Pot, Taiwanese-style

Third-floor restaurant in The Atelier building with 360° karst mountain views from indoor and outdoor terrace. Interactive format: Mongolian BBQ (Taiwanese-style, expertly roasted meats) or Chinese Hot Pot at live cooking stations. Reservation required for dinner. Also serves late breakfast. The most visually distinctive dining experience on the property.

The Atelier (Main Restaurant)

Included

International, Regional Chinese, Japanese, Mediterranean

Main buffet, all three meals. International spread with strong Chinese regional emphasis: Sichuanese, Cantonese, Hainan dishes, grilled meats, Japanese, Mediterranean. Live cooking stations. Indoor themed rooms and outdoor terrace. The daily rotation is broader than most Club Med China properties. Casual dress (cover-up required over swimwear).

The Noodle Bar

Included

Chinese Noodles

Casual noodle bar with regional Guilin specialties: braised Guilin thick noodle soup, Guilin rice noodles, osmanthus rice cake. Live stations throughout lunch, snack periods, and late dinner. No reservation required. The best place to eat the local specialty the region is actually known for.

The Atelier Bar

Included

Bar snacks

Main bar, daytime through early evening. Indoor and outdoor terrace. Fruit juices, cocktails, local spirits. Social center of the resort. Casual.

Moon Bar

Included

Drinks

Adults-only (12+) bar in the HOMA building. Quiet lounge atmosphere, fine wines, tree-lined outdoor terrace. Evening only. Smart casual. The quieter alternative for guests in the HOMA hotel.

Poolside Bar

Included

Drinks, Light snacks

Outdoor bar by the pool. Daytime only, seasonal (typically May–October). Mojitos and refreshing drinks. Casual/swimwear with cover-up.
